web-dev-qa-db-ja.com

12.10へのアップグレード後、Unityのトップバー、サイドバー、ウィンドウ装飾が表示されない

Update Managerを使用して12.04.1から12.10にアップグレードしましたが、アップグレードは正常に完了したと言いましたが、Unityタスクバーを再起動した後、起動バーとウィンドウの装飾が表示されませんでした。

すべてのcompiz設定は削除されたように見え、最初の起動時にシステムエラーが発生しました。デスクトップが存在し、compizの設定を台無しにしたことを思い出したら、押すだけでした。 Ctrl+Alt+F1 そして、仮想端末でunity --resetに続いてSudo rebootと入力します。

オペレーティングシステム全体を再インストールしたかのように、すべてが機能しました。今回はこう言った:

Warning no variable set. setting to :0. The reset option is now dupricated.

今何をするつもりですか?確実にインストールされたいくつかのプログラムとその中のデータが必要なので、できるだけ早くこれを修正する必要があります(長い話)。

10
Nick Bailuc

私はついにUnityを通常の解像度に戻しました。compizはいつものように動作します(明らかに)。以前ほどきびきびした感じはしませんが、少なくとも私はそれで作業できます。

これは私がやったことです(他の人を助けることを願っています):

  • xorg.confファイルを @ RobertPitt が推奨されているようにリセットしようとしました(実際、私にとっては何もしませんでした)。

  • 次に、 @ Freedom が提案したものを試しましたが、追加のドライバータブ内にエントリがありませんでした。

  • しばらくGoogleで検索し、 this pageおよび this pageで説明されている手順を試しました。最初のWebページの手順を実行しても、何も変わりません。 2番目のページについては、ATIドライバーパッケージを取得できませんでした。

  • フラストレーションから、Sudo apt-get autoremove fglrx --purgefglrxを取り除き、Sudo shutdown -r nowを再起動しました。

再起動後、すべてが正常に見え、正常に機能しているように見えました。とても奇妙。

ところで、私はRadeon HD 3400(RV620)カードを持っていますが、追加のドライバータブには独自のドライバーのエントリがまだありません。

11

したがって、まったく同じ問題が発生しました。これらは、すべてを正常に機能させるために行った手順です。

まず、解像度の警告があったので、tty1を使用してxorgの設定をクリアしました(Ctrl+Alt+F1)、ログインして次のコマンドを実行します:

Sudo su -
cp /etc/X11/xorg.conf /etc/X11/xorg.conf.back
echo "" > /etc/X11/xorg.conf
reboot -r now

次に、re-install packagesコマンドを実行して、次のものを使用してすべてを更新しました。

Sudo apt-get install -r

最後に、完了したら、次を使用してマシンを再起動します。

Sudo reboot -r now

この時点ですべてが再び機能し始め、NVidiaのグラフィック設定をやり直すだけです。

2
RobertPitt

こっちも一緒。 https://help.ubuntu.com/community/BinaryDriverHowto/ATI に従ってfglrxを削除すると、上記の問題が修正されました。 fglrxを再インストールする必要はありませんでした

1
bubuntu

AMD Radeon HD 7750を持っていることを除いて、同じ問題がありました。

上記の回答に従ってみましたが、運がありませんでした。

私にとってうまくいったのは、プロプライエタリなドライバーに変更することでした。ここに私がやったことがあります:

  1. デスクトップを右クリックし、「デスクトップの背景を変更」を選択します。
  2. 上部にある[すべての設定]をクリックします(システム設定に入るより良い方法があるかもしれませんが、これはUnityを起動せずにそれを行うことができる唯一の方法です)。
  3. 下にスクロールして[ソフトウェアリソース]をクリックし、[追加ドライバー]タブをクリックします。
  4. 「x.org xserver- AMD/ATIディスプレイドライバラッパーをxserver-zorg-video-ATIから使用する(Open Scource、テスト済み)」ではなく、「fglrx(proprietary)からAMDグラフィックアクセラレータにビデオドライバを使用する」に切り替えます。
  5. 「変更を適用」をクリックします
  6. その後、プレス Ctrl+Alt+Del ログオフして再起動するには

再起動後、Unityは正常に動作するはずです。これが永続的な修正なのか、一時的な修正なのかわかりません。

私はそれを動作させた後、Linux AMDドライバーを再インストールしようとしましたが、AMDサイトからダウンロードし、それが再びUnityを壊したことを指摘したいと思います。再び機能させるには、このプロセスを繰り返す必要がありました。

ありがとう、これが役立つことを願っています=)

1
Freedom

私は同じ問題を抱えていて、上記の推奨手順のいくつかを試してみましたが、ほとんど結果はありませんでした。最終的に、 https://help.ubuntu.com/community/BinaryDriverHowto/ATI の指示に従って、独自のドライバーを手動でインストールしようと試み始めました。

ステップ2を実行した後

Sudo apt-get remove --purge fglrx-updates fglrx-amdcccle-updates

そして、すべてを再起動すると、ドライバーをインストールすることなく通常に戻りました(ただし、グラフィックスではシステム情報が不明であるため、現在ドライバーなしで実行しています)

0
movin

私はLinuxの初心者で、何をしているのかわかりませんが、この問題をどのように修正したのでしょうか。以前のカーネルで起動しました。再起動すると、起動するオペレーティングシステムを尋ねる画面で詳細オプションを選択し、インストールされているカーネルを表示します。 2番目のカーネル(最新の更新の直前)で起動し、すべてが正常に起動しました。それから

Sudo apt-get update
Sudo apt-get upgrade

システムを再起動し、正常に起動させてください。

0
Thomas Johnsen